Tim Verwaart is a scholar working on Artificial Intelligence, Management Information Systems and Sociology and Political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Tim Verwaart has authored 15 papers receiving a total of 362 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 4 papers in Artificial Intelligence, 4 papers in Management Information Systems and 3 papers in Sociology and Political Science. Recurrent topics in Tim Verwaart’s work include Conflict Management and Negotiation (2 papers), Evolutionary Game Theory and Cooperation (2 papers) and Product Development and Customization (2 papers). Tim Verwaart is often cited by papers focused on Conflict Management and Negotiation (2 papers), Evolutionary Game Theory and Cooperation (2 papers) and Product Development and Customization (2 papers). Tim Verwaart collaborates with scholars based in The Netherlands, Lebanon and Iran. Tim Verwaart's co-authors include C.N. Verdouw, Gert Jan Hofstede, J. Wolfert, A.J.M. Beulens, Catholijn M. Jonker, Wim Heijman, Ahmad Baraani-Dastjerdi, Mohammad Ali Nematbakhsh, Jacques Trienekens and K.J. Poppe and has published in prestigious journals such as Knowledge-Based Systems, Environmental Modelling & Software and Computers in Industry.
